XP GAME SUMMIT 2025 RETURNS TO TORONTO DURING OFFICIAL VIDEO GAME MONTH

Major industry conference welcomes over 300 companies, 17 publishers, and top speakers to connect, grow, and shape Canada’s $5.1B games sector

June 9, 2025, Toronto, ON - XP Game Summit 2025 returns to the Hyatt Regency Toronto, June 12-13, as part of the City of Toronto’s newly proclaimed Video Game Month. Produced by XP Gaming Inc., the two-day B2B conference connects developers, publishers, investors, service providers, and platforms for business-focused networking and insights that support the growth of Canada’s globally competitive games industry.


Canada’s video game sector contributes $5.1 billion annually to national GDP, with 88% of games made in Canada sold internationally offering a high-value, low-footprint economic opportunity for digital exports. 


“The Mayoral proclamation of June as Video Game Month is a powerful recognition of our industry’s economic and cultural impact,” said Jason Lepine, Founder & CEO of XP Gaming Inc. “XP Game Summit builds on that momentum by connecting creators, funders, and partners to drive real business, global growth, and lasting value for Canada’s digital economy.”


This year’s XP Game Summit will welcome over 300 companies and 17 attending publishers - almost triple the previous year - reflecting continued demand for export-ready content, collaboration, and creative IP. The B2B summit is one of seven major events contributing to Video Game Month in Toronto, expected to attract over 40,000 attendees across June. The City’s official proclamation highlights gaming as a cultural and economic force, with crossover innovation in film, AI, and immersive technology.


Industry Speakers and Programming


With more than 44 sessions, panels, and workshops, XP25 programming focuses on business success in a competitive global market - covering funding, publishing, IP, UX, marketing, and production.


Select talks include:
 

  • Fireside chat with Sheldon Carter, President, Digital Extremes
  • We Created a Global Gaming IP – And So Can You
  • Owning the Player Relationship: How Direct-to-Consumer is Reshaping Game Growth
  • Mastering AI for Game Development – From “FGF” to Final Release
  • The Audience Imperative: Building Live Time Value of Indie Game Companies
  • It Takes a Village: Bringing Narrative to Disney Dreamlight Valley
  • Moderate to Modify: Using AI and Psychology to Build Safer, Healthier Gaming Communities


Speakers represent a broad cross-section of the global industry, including leaders from Epic Games, Ubisoft, Riot Games, Finji, Telefilm Canada, Digital Extremes, Serenity Forge, Indie Asylum, and Xsolla, among others.


The event also features XP’s largest Indie Showcase to date with over 40 games, expanded business matchmaking powered by MeetToMatch, and community-focused events like the VIP Welcome Mixer and Indie Pitch Competition.

About XP Gaming Inc:


XP Gaming helps global video game companies grow through business development, strategic visibility, and high-impact connections.


As the producer of XP Game Summit, Montreal International Game Summit (MIGS), and XP Indie Biz Connect, XP Gaming drives growth by connecting game professionals with insights, innovation, and opportunities for collaboration.
